您的位置:首页 > 编程语言 > C语言/C++

c++中的循环

2012-12-08 16:07 197 查看
刚开始的时候,只知道有

int i;

for(i=0;i<n;i++){}

后来,为了减少出错,把int i写到了括号里边,

for(int i=0;i<v.size();i++){}

然后,学会了用iterator,写成了

for(vector<Int>::iterator itr=v.begin();itr!=v.end();itr++){}

代码变得很长,最近学了python中的循环

for item in v,

发现原来迭代可以写的这么简单,boost库中也提供了类似的功能

BOOST_FOREACH(int item,v){}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: